Biography:
Sam Goldstein, Ph.D. is an Assistant Clinical Instructor at the
University of Utah School of Medicine and on staff at the University
Neuropsychiatric Institute. He is Clinical Director of the Neurology Learning
and Behavior Center. The Center conducts evaluations, consultation and the
provides treatment services to nearly 400 individuals and families each year.
Dr. Goldstein has authored fifty trade and science texts as well as over fifty
science based book chapters and peer reviewed research articles. He has also
co-authored six psychological tests. He currently serves as Editor in Chief of
the Journal of Attention Disorders and sits on the editorial boards of six peer
reviewed journals.
He is Co-editor of the Encyclopedia of Child Development. Recent books
include the Handbook of Resilience – 2nd Edition, Raising Resilient Children
with Autism Spectrum Disorders, Handbooks of Neurodevelopmental and Genetic
Disorders in Children and Adults, Assessment of Intelligence and Achievement,
Assessment of Autism Spectrum Disorders, Handbook of Executive Functioning,
Assessment of Impairment and Managing Children’s Classroom Behavior: Creating
Sustainable Resilient Classrooms. He is the co-author of the Autism Spectrum
Rating Scales, Comprehensive Executive Functioning Inventory, Rating Scales of
Impairment and the Cognitive Assessment System Second Edition.
Currently he has three books and four psychological tests in
development. He has lectured to thousands of professionals and the lay public
in the U.S., South America, Asia, Australia and Europe.
